[Bug 2096844] Re: site search configuration lost

2025-03-04 Thread Nathan Teodosio
https://source.chromium.org/chromium/chromium/src/+/8f27215905d58990fc1805be2ace4350b81e77fb
is maybe a hint:

> In order to detect corruption of this table, a new 'url_hash'
column is added to the 'keywords' table in 'Web Data'.
>
> This contains an encrypted hash of 'url' and 'id'.
>
> Records where this hash does not match are dropped when the
table is loaded.
>
> The 'Web Data' database version is updated to 137 to reflect this
and tests are added to verify the new behavior.

[Bug 2100719] Re: Not able to change fan speed

2025-03-04 Thread Daniel Letzeisen
"But why is it not possible by default?"
Probably because these Super I/O chips generally use the ISA bus and require 
probing. It's not like a PCI device where the dev can just alias the PCI ID. 
Then you have chips like the it87 family which often require force loading and 
could have side effects ("This is inherently risky since it means that both 
ACPI and this driver may access the chip at the same time. This can result in 
race conditions and, worst case, result in unexpected system reboots.")

"How should one know to run the mentioned command in order to make pwmconfig 
work?"
The error message tells you that you need an appropriate kernel module. If you 
think it should explicitly suggest sensors-detect, maybe open an issue at: 
https://github.com/lm-sensors/lm-sensors/issues

  [Impact]
  When the user is in the `input` group and has access to the inodes under
  `/dev/input/`, running a simple "SDL_Init(SDL_JOYSTICK)" takes
  significantly longer in 2.30 than in earlier releases, on the order of
  seconds compared with fractions of seconds.
  
- 
  [Test Case]
  1. Install `python3-sdl2` and `python3-uinput` packages with:
  
-$ sudo apt install -y python3-sdl2 python3-uinput
+    $ sudo apt install -y python3-sdl2 python3-uinput
  
  2. Download the script used by RetroPie, which uses SDL2 and uinput to
  simulate a keyboard with:
  
- curl -o test.py https://pastebin.ubuntu.com/p/7SZ4Z7X9Sb/.
+ wget
+ 
https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/libsdl2/+bug/2085140/+attachment/5862276/+files/test.py
  
  3. Run the repro script by executing:
-sudo python3 test.py
+    sudo python3 test.py
  
  It will log two lines, before and after 'SDL_Init' is run so you can
  measure the delay.  It should be a fraction of a second.
  
  [Where Problems Could Occur]
  
  * Mis-detected input devices
  * Issues during input detection
  * Performance issues before / after this change
  
  [Other Info]
  
  The slowness is believed to be due to calls to SDL_UDEV_GetProductInfo()
  for each input device starting with commit 3b1e0e1, rather than only
  joystick devices as had been done previously.  Specifically, IsJoystick
  calls SDL_UDEV_GetProductInfo(), which then performs a walk of all
  devices via udev_enumerate_scan_devices.  The performance impact occurs
  during the (synchronous) *closing* of the device file, which can take
  0.01 to 0.5 sec.  For a system with 1 joystick but 20-ish other input
  devices, this can represent a 20-fold increase in time consumed during
  detection.
  
  The fix is to avoid opening device files by filtering out ones that are
  not joystick or accelerometer classes, or if the vendor+product doesn't
  indicate a Steam virtual game pad.
  
  [Original Report]
  
  Hello,
  
   the 2.30.0 SDL2 release included in 24.04 LTS (Noble) contains a
  regression [1] in regard to the initializaton of the Joystick/Gamepad
  detection. When the user is in the `input` group and has access to the
  inodes under `/dev/input/`, running a simple "SDL_Init(SDL_JOYSTICK)"
  takes about 0.5 sec per device node.
  
   In my/our case (https://retropie.org.uk), we're using a Python3 script
  that uses 'python3-sdl2' and 'python3-uinput' to create a virtual
  keyboard device from inputs received from a gamepad. When launching a
  game, the user has the opportunity to open a 'dialog' based menu and
  configure the game, but if the initialization takes a long time, the
  input from the gamepad is lost and the game configuration is not
  started.
  
   Please consider including the patch for the reported issue [1] - it's
  in [2] - or upgrade to 2.30.3 which contains the fix [3].
  
  best regards,
  
  [1] https://github.com/libsdl-org/sdl/issues/9092/
  [2] https://github.com/libsdl-org/SDL/pull/9450/files
  [3] https://github.com/libsdl-org/SDL/releases/tag/release-2.30.3
